    Default 18rg 2.2l ???

    hey, im looking at ways to modify my 18rg while it is out of my ute... how does the 2.2L conversion go? what is needed to complete it and has anyone on here done this mod before

    im am rebuilding my engine now and advice would be nice

    Default Re: 18rg 2.2l ???

    You will need to bored the block out to suit 22-RE pistons, In terms of performance,
    yes you get a gain but Cams or going efi would probably yeild similar gains for less trouble.

    I think 22-RE pistons are 92.5 bringing the capacity out to 2150cc.

    Default Re: 18rg 2.2l ???

    Just note that there is a difference between boring it out to 2.2l and stroking it out to 2.4l

    The 2.2 (or 2150) is a rebore and correct pistons so if you are rebuilding the engine anyway it is not so bad. Mine ran 22-RE pistons however I planed to get custom forgies as the Cams had to be advanced or retarded to stop collisions

    For the 2.4l the magical formula is 22-RE pistons, 22r/20r crank, 16r rods however these are rare as rocking horse p00. so mod work to the18r seems the way to go , but this is exxy.
